Output d3bbcf2f2a93009db5be0a112f367bb46742e5eabd35ae47bbc0e55bdfe252fc:1

value
1272861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592a6dd7eb8bba51b21fa8a6cd636524cce74603 OP_EQUAL
address
39pUte72Wj65CsSdfyjhgFUf2LpTu2thXB
transaction
d3bbcf2f2a93009db5be0a112f367bb46742e5eabd35ae47bbc0e55bdfe252fc
confirmations
303640
spent
true